With its unique three-part structure, Rock’n’Roll Unravelled tells the story of Rock’n’Roll from its roots to mid-1970s punk. Not just the story of the music but also the social factors, such as the Vietnam War and Civil Rights struggle, which had a considerable influence on the sounds of the day.
